I am after advice on seat padding for a Corbeau Sprint - In order to run a harness safely and get a good driving position, I have to run the seat without the base and leg padding (I am 6'4"). I don't mind this except for when I have been in the car for 10 minutes and my pelvis turns to dust.

Does anyone know anywhere that sells 20mm-30mm thick base cushions made to fit? Or should I just have a bash at making my own?
